Can People with Myopia Play Ping Pong?

👀 Have you ever wondered if people with myopia can play ping pong? As someone who has been wearing glasses since childhood, I can confidently say that yes, they can! 😊

🏓 Ping pong, also known as table tennis, is a sport that requires good hand-eye coordination and quick reflexes. While myopia may seem like a hindrance, it doesn't have to stop you from enjoying this exciting game. Here are some tips for myopic players to excel in ping pong:

  1. 👓 Wear Glasses or Contact Lenses: As a myopic person, wearing glasses or contact lenses is essential for clear vision. This will help you track the ball and make accurate shots. 🎉

  2. 🏃‍♂️ Practice Your Stance: A proper stance is crucial for maintaining balance and quick movements. Keep your feet shoulder-width apart, bend your knees slightly, and stay relaxed. 💪

  3. 🎯 Focus on the Ball: Keep your eyes on the ball at all times. This will help you anticipate its trajectory and react accordingly. 🎯

  4. 🏃‍♀️ Be Quick on Your Feet: Ping pong requires quick movements. Practice your footwork to improve your speed and agility. 🏃‍♀️

  5. 🎯 Develop a Strategy: Work with your coach or play with friends to develop a winning strategy. Understanding your strengths and weaknesses will help you play more effectively. 🎯

  6. 🧘‍♂️ Stay Fit: Regular exercise can improve your overall health and performance in ping pong. Stay active and maintain a healthy lifestyle. 🧘‍♂️

  7. 🎉 Don't Give Up: Remember that success takes time and effort. Don't be discouraged by setbacks. Keep practicing, and you'll see improvement. 🎉

👀 In conclusion, myopia should not be a barrier to playing ping pong. With the right approach and dedication, you can excel in this sport. So, grab your paddle, put on your glasses, and have fun on the table! 🎉🏓
